On 4/17/10 1:06 AM, Ron wrote:
You need to update to the latest subversion Nmap version - none of the released versions has those scripts (yet).

Something I've been pushing for, and that I'm hoping will get looked at when GSoC rolls around, is having a way to 
auto-update the scripts without updating Nmap. Something like Nessus, OpenVAS, etc can do. But for now, you're going to have to 
compile the latest SVN version (or check it out and copy over the scripts).


Sounds like  a good idea, though we will likely need to expose the NSE version or a capability
level so that scripts can ensure that the version of nmap running the script has the required
feature set.
